What to look out for when you are using Findababysitter.com
Unfortunately scammers occasionally target childcare job seekers, so pleases be diligent and protect yourself! Look out for the “same old stuff” and clever tricks design to get you to hand over your personal details such as your bank account details and home address.
Keep an eye out for phony jobs posted on the website or messages from users with a sad story or a job opportunity that’s just too good to be true. As a rule, if it seems too good to be true it probably is!
To avoid falling into a trap laid by a phony employer find out as much as you can about the person(s) before agreeing to an interview and before taking up a position e.g. if you are a nanny find out the family’s home address, their landline phone number, name and ages of children. If you have any doubts, contact us.
Our advice to all community members is simple
ALWAYS meet prospective employers face to face. Never accept a job from a person you have not met who says they live overseas and offer to pay you prior to your meeting them. This sounds too good to be true and it probably is!
NEVER provide your bank account details when applying for a job. This is only necessary after you have interviewed in person, accepted the job offer and actually started working.
NEVER disclose your home or personal address to anyone over the internet.
NEVER disclose your address or bank account details to anyone over the internet.
What to do if you think you’ve spotted a scammer on Findababysitter.com
You can help Findababysitter.com stop scammers by reporting anyone that requests your bank account details in advance of employment.
If you are contacted by phone or email by a user who you suspect to be a scammer do not disclose any further details and contact us straight away.
